Output 5efd69641d34bc339cd559fa774d92163d5695ff269685c338d4e767438ce799:1

value
21191974743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1ac26d87ace003a90cccc6fb2b8a1f62512ea95 OP_EQUALVERIFY OP_CHECKSIG
address
1Fjr2CSr7z225oiZFBLA91jwBz2on6DcPZ
transaction
5efd69641d34bc339cd559fa774d92163d5695ff269685c338d4e767438ce799
confirmations
510017
spent
true